The tenth largest City in Canada and the regional centre for Southwestern Ontario, London's geographical focal point is the Forks of the Thames. Today's city of more than 450,000 residents fans out for miles beyond the original site but the downtown remains a primary commercial and retail centre with residential areas that include heritage buildings as well as modern condominium complexes.
